If you enjoy this element, a Mission Mode lets you really focus on shooting ghosts. However, as in the past, one does offer infinite film, so you’re never truly left prone. There are also different sorts of film that can be acquired to help with damaging your opponents as you line up perfectly timed shots to dispel them. As usual, you can happen upon lenses while you venture through the island’s locations, which can make encounters with ghosts much easier. However, I did prefer and would recommend using the analog sticks for aiming. I was pleasantly surprised to see both the standard and gyroscopic controls both work quite well. A camera and flashlight, respectively, each one is capable of damaging the ghosts and saving your life. That alone is a blessing given how often a ghost will pop up out of nowhere to sap your will to live with a single touch.īesides, you have the Camera Obscura and Spirit Torch. You are, for the most part, playing as terrified young women who are also suffering from Moonlight Syndrome. He’s the detective who found all five girls that day while investigating Yo Haibara, and Ruka’s mother called upon him to come back to find her daughter. So they return, as does Choshiro Kirishima. The survivors are convinced the answers to what happened, and their hopes of surviving whatever claimed the lives of their friends, are back on that island. All five young women lost all memories of their lives prior to that moment. Years ago, Ruka Minazuki, Misaki Aso, Madoka Tsukimori, and two of their friends were found after an incident on Rogetsu Isle.
